What Preparation Strategies Help Candidates to Pass the CompTIA PK0-005 Exam?
Passing PK0-005 isn't about knowing project management theory. It's about using that theory in messy real-world cases. That's the trap. You can read every framework twice and still miss questions that ask you to make a judgment call.
The CompTIA Project+ certification tests ideas like scope budget and risk. But most questions frame these as situations not definitions. You'll get a scenario with a stakeholder conflict or a shifting deadline. Your job is picking the best next step not repeating a term.
Terms like "critical path" or "change control" matter for sure. What matters more is knowing when and why you'd use them in order. Try walking through a full project lifecycle in your head. Start to finish. That mental practice sticks longer than flashcards ever will.
Communication and stakeholder management questions catch people off guard. They feel less "technical" so candidates under-study them. That's a mistake. The pk0 005 exam weighs these areas heavily and they're often where prep gaps show up first.
Reading builds familiarity but it doesn't prepare you for recalling answers under time pressure. That difference only becomes clear once the clock is running.
